‘Infinite strength’ has weird limits in fiction, but can usually be troped in three big, easy ways. The first is to threaten something that character cares deeply about. He may be invincible, but his world is not.
The other is to have them at limited potentials of that power, or limit them by their incompetence or inexperience. This is the Matthew Malloy or Scarlet Witch situation, they had/have power but are sometimes written with zero control of that power.
The last and easiest, is to use abilities that do not depend on strength. Strength is always troped by magic and telepathic users of at least some skill. Can’t kill what you’re fighting? Teleport it to hell! Trick its mind into fighting someone else. Trick it into thinking there’s nothing wrong, or Charles Xavier’s method, ‘you sleep now’.
Though there are sometimes limits to that. See - The Hulk.
